Although Liverpool couldn’t complete the addition of Aurelien Tchouaméni to join Fábio Carvalho as the newest additions to their roster, given that he preferred the offer made by Real Madrid, they now have moved from the rejection and have set their eyes in a new player.

Tchouaméni was followed not only by Liverpool and Real Madrid, but also PSG was involved in the conversations with Ligue 1 side AS Monaco, and even if the three teams were prepared to pay the transfer fee asked by the Les Rouges et Blancs, it was up to him to decide where he wanted to play.

Ultimately, the 22-year-old midfielder decided to play for Los Blancos next season, according to RMC Sport, although now that Real Madrid has the green light to start negotiations with Monaco, they will try to lower the $100 million plus add-ons transfer fee that they are asking for him.

While Liverpool have become the second choice for the French midfielder, they already moved on and are targeting their next addition, as reports from Sports Ilustrated inform that The Reds are already in negotiations with Eredivisie side PSV Eindhoven to sign Ibrahim Sangaré.

 

At least four other Premier League teams are on the race for Sangaré

But the road to sign the 24-year-old defensive midfielder will be more complicated for Liverpool than expected, as the Ivory Coast international has become one of the top targets for Premier League teams for the summer transfer window.

Along Liverpool, Newcastle United, Leicester City, Aston Villa, and most recently Chelsea are on the race to sign him. Steven Gerrard is still rebuilding Villa’s roster, and Sangaré could help him to have a solid midfield. While Leicester City are looking to return to the top places of Premier League.

Although for Chelsea Sangaré is the second option if they can’t sign Declan Rice out of West Ham, Newcastle United has the Ivorian as a priority, as they are still trying to build a competitive team after failing to sign big names over the winter transfer window.

 

Who is the favorite on the race to sign Sangaré?

According to reports from Sports Illustrated and sports journalist Ekrem Konur, Liverpool are the favorite team to acquire Sangaré over the summer, as they are ready to start negotiations. His addition will be for a sum between $32 million and $37.5 million.
